How they compare

Germany currently reports 69.95 kilograms per hectare against 66.97 kilograms per hectare in Botswana, a difference of 2.98 kilograms per hectare.

Across all 56 years both countries report, Germany has been ahead every year.

Botswana ranks 53rd and Germany ranks 51st of 201 countries.

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Botswana Germany Difference Ahead
1960s 3.6 kilograms per hectare 77.84 kilograms per hectare 74.24 kilograms per hectare Germany
1970s 2.65 kilograms per hectare 123.39 kilograms per hectare 120.74 kilograms per hectare Germany
1980s 0.973 kilograms per hectare 143.96 kilograms per hectare 142.99 kilograms per hectare Germany
1990s 6.56 kilograms per hectare 118.58 kilograms per hectare 112.02 kilograms per hectare Germany
2000s 24.98 kilograms per hectare 115.19 kilograms per hectare 90.21 kilograms per hectare Germany
2010s 48.44 kilograms per hectare 107.54 kilograms per hectare 59.1 kilograms per hectare Germany
2020s 57.42 kilograms per hectare 74.31 kilograms per hectare 16.89 kilograms per hectare Germany

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
